Blue Ridge Mountains Backpacking, Rock Climbing & Whitewater Canoeing for Girls

Blue ridge mtns backpacking, climbing & canoeing For girls

This classic, multi-activity, girl’s-only course offers the same challenges as any Outward Bound expedition, with the added focus of sharing this leadership experience with other young girls. The course will be led by a passionate, talented female instructor.  On this course, participants will discover what it’s like to live, work and play in the great outdoors of Western North Carolina. The expedition will take students deep into some of the oldest mountains in the world, over mountain faces and through racing rivers.
